Description

Cholest-5-Ene-3,7,22-Triol is a high-purity sterol derivative, a key intermediate in the synthesis of complex bioactive molecules. Its precise chemical structure makes it an essential building block for research and development in advanced pharmaceutical and fine chemical applications. This compound is particularly valuable for scientists and manufacturers working on steroid-based drug discovery, vitamin D analogs, and other specialized biochemical pathways.

Application

  • Pharmaceutical Intermediate: A critical starting material or intermediate in the synthesis of novel steroid-based therapeutics and active pharmaceutical ingredients (APIs).
  • Biochemical Research: Used as a reference standard or precursor in metabolic pathway studies, enzyme inhibition assays, and receptor binding research.
  • Fine Chemical Synthesis: Serves as a chiral building block for the production of complex, high-value specialty chemicals and advanced materials.
  • Vitamin D Analog Development: A key precursor in the research and development of vitamin D metabolites and related analogs with potential therapeutic applications.
  • Academic & Industrial R&D: Employed in laboratories for method development, process chemistry optimization, and exploratory synthesis projects.

Basic Information

Product Name Cholest-5-Ene-3,7,22-Triol
CAS No. 104786-66-5
Molecular Formula C₂₇H₄₆O₃
Molecular Weight 418.66 g/mol
Synonyms 3β,7α,22-Trihydroxycholest-5-ene; (3β,7α,22R)-Cholest-5-ene-3,7,22-triol; 22R-Hydroxycholesterol (7α-hydroxy derivative); 7α,22-Dihydroxycholesterol; Cholest-5-ene-3β,7α,22(R)-triol; 5-Cholestene-3β,7α,22-triol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This product is hygroscopic (moisture-sensitive) and should be handled in a dry environment to prevent degradation. For long-term storage, consider desiccant or inert atmosphere conditions.
